Market Research in Nagoya, Japan: How Industrial Leaders Win the Chubu Region

Nagoya is the operational heart of Japanese manufacturing. Toyota, DENSO, Aisin, Brother, Yamaha Motor, and Mitsubishi Heavy Industries anchor a supplier network that produces nearly half of Japan’s automotive output and a disproportionate share of its precision machinery, ceramics, and aerospace components. For Fortune 500 industrial firms, Market Research in Nagoya Japan is the entry point to procurement decisions that shape global supply chains.

The Chubu region rewards research that respects how decisions actually move inside keiretsu-aligned buyers. Tier-one suppliers commit only after multi-year qualification cycles. Plant managers, not headquarters, often hold the decisive vote on equipment standardization. Research designed for Tokyo head offices misses where the orders are placed.

Why Nagoya Operates Differently From Tokyo and Osaka

Tokyo runs on financial and policy signals. Osaka runs on commerce. Nagoya runs on monozukuri, the manufacturing craft discipline that prioritizes process integrity, supplier loyalty, and total cost of ownership over headline price. Buyers expect counterparties to demonstrate technical fluency before commercial conversation begins.

This shapes every research instrument. A B2B expert interview in Nagoya needs an engineer-grade discussion guide. Concept tests for industrial equipment require working drawings, material specifications, and field-service economics. Generic value-proposition probes return polite answers and no insight.

SIS International Research has found across decades of B2B engagements in Chubu that procurement managers at automotive tier-ones disclose strategic intent only after the interviewer demonstrates command of bill of materials structures, supplier qualification audits, and the kaizen review cadence that governs annual cost-down negotiations.

The Industrial Concentration That Defines the Opportunity

Aichi Prefecture leads Japan in manufacturing shipment value. The cluster extends into Gifu and Mie, covering machine tools (Yamazaki Mazak, Okuma), robotics (FANUC partners and tier suppliers), aerospace (Mitsubishi Heavy Industries, Kawasaki Heavy Industries airframe work), and advanced ceramics (NGK, Noritake). Toyota’s transition toward battery electric vehicles and hydrogen platforms is reshaping component demand across the entire supplier base.

This concentration creates a research advantage. Installed base analytics, OEM procurement analysis, and aftermarket revenue strategy can be validated against a defined population of buyers. Total cost of ownership models built from Nagoya field data tend to predict adoption curves across Japan’s broader industrial base.

Methodologies That Work in the Chubu Region

Four approaches consistently produce decision-grade intelligence for industrial clients entering or expanding in Nagoya.

B2B expert interviews with plant-level engineers. Decisions on capital equipment, automation, and consumables are made by maintenance leads, production engineers, and quality managers. Their candor exceeds what corporate procurement will share, and their views predict purchase outcomes more reliably.

Ethnographic research on the factory floor. Observed workflows reveal where reshoring feasibility, predictive maintenance sizing, and supplier qualification audits actually break down. What buyers say in conference rooms rarely matches what operators do at the line.

Competitive intelligence on local incumbents. Domestic suppliers compete on relationship tenure and engineering responsiveness, not on RFP scoring. Mapping their service economics, dealer coverage, and aftermarket margins is essential before pricing a market entry.

Market entry assessments tied to keiretsu mapping. Toyota Group, Mitsubishi Group, and Sumitomo affiliations still gate access to many tier-one accounts. Research that ignores group structure produces forecasts that overshoot achievable share by wide margins.

What Distinguishes High-Performing Research in Nagoya

SIS International’s structured interview programs with senior procurement and engineering leaders across Aichi, Gifu, and Shizuoka indicate that the firms winning share in Chubu treat research as a continuous capability rather than a discrete project, refreshing buyer maps and competitive positioning on the same cadence as the annual supplier review cycle.

Three patterns separate effective programs from the rest.

Bilingual research teams with industrial backgrounds. Translation alone does not carry technical nuance. Moderators who have worked in or studied Japanese manufacturing extract specifications and concerns that surface-level interviewers miss.

Long-cycle relationship building with respondents. Japanese industrial respondents reward continuity. The second and third interview yield disclosures the first never will. Single-touch fieldwork undervalues the market.

Triangulation across Tokyo, Osaka, and Nagoya. Strategy is set in Tokyo, distribution often runs through Osaka, and production decisions sit in Nagoya. Research that samples only one node produces partial answers.

Sectors Driving Demand for Market Research in Nagoya Japan

Automotive electrification. Toyota’s multi-pathway strategy across BEV, hybrid, and hydrogen creates parallel supplier opportunities in battery cells, power electronics, thermal management, and fuel cell components. Each requires distinct buyer research.

Industrial automation and robotics. Labor demographics are accelerating adoption of collaborative robots, machine vision, and predictive maintenance platforms across mid-sized Chubu manufacturers that historically resisted automation.

Aerospace and defense components. Mitsubishi Heavy Industries and its supplier base support both domestic programs and Boeing airframe work. Reshoring feasibility studies and DFARS-equivalent compliance assessments are increasingly requested.

Advanced materials and ceramics. Demand from semiconductor, EV battery, and medical device markets is reshaping the ceramics cluster around Seto and Tajimi.

Where Programs Underperform and How Leaders Correct It

Programs underperform when they treat Nagoya as a sampling point rather than a decision center. Headquarters-led studies that survey Tokyo executives and extrapolate to procurement reality miss the engineering criteria that govern actual orders. Leading firms correct this by routing field research through Nagoya-based teams, weighting plant-level voices, and validating findings against installed base data before committing to forecasts.

The firms that build durable share in Chubu invest in research as infrastructure. They sustain expert panels, refresh competitive intelligence quarterly, and run voice-of-customer programs that track the same accounts across product cycles. The compounding effect on win rates and qualification speed is significant.
